$1675 at 4.6% for 4 years whats the interest earned and balance amount

If simple interest is paid:
Interest=Pit = 1675*0.046*4=308.20

If compounded annually
Interest=P[(1+i)^t-1]=1675*(1.046^4-1)=330.13

If compounded monthly
Interest=P[(1+i/12)^(t*12)-1]=1675*((1+0.046/12)^(4*12)-1)=337.67

Please be sure to specify the type of interest and compounding period if it is compound interest.

Is it possible that the image of a point after a reflection could be the same point as the preimage?
Vera_Pavlovna [14]
Yes, it is possible. For example, let's say that point A is (0,4) and there's a reflection over the y-axis, then point A would still be (0,4).
